Scientists at the University of Utah led by researcher Richard Rabbitt, have found a way to stimulate inner ear cells with infrared laser light. Using low-powered optical signals, the researchers triggered the inner ear hair cells of an oyster toadfish to send signals to its brain, raising the possibility of using the technology to restore hearing to the deaf. A high-tech form of miniaturized radar capable of detecting incoming fire will be added to some soldiers' arsenals starting later this month. The Army just announced plans to ship 13,000 of the card-deck-sized Individual Gunshot Detectors to troops in Afghanistan.
Four sensors detect soundwaves emitted by distant gunfire, while a monitor transmits information on its origins to the soldier. ...

Researchers in Germany have developed a new endoscopic camera that's cheap enough to be thrown away after each use, and small enough to see eye-to-eye with a grain of rice.
Designed at Germany's Fraunhofer Institute for Reliability and Microintegration, the prototype's camera is just one cubic millimeter in size, and features a resolution of 62,500 pixels. But researchers say it's still ...

Um, amazing? Promessa is a Swedish company that will freeze your dead body to -18 degrees Celsius, dip it in liquid nitrogen, and then shatter it with sound waves. The resulting "organic powder" is then "introduced into a vacuum chamber where the water is evaporated away," before being sealed in a coffin made from biodegradable cornstarch. A new study from the National Institutes of Health suggests that using cell phones can change the way our brains behave, though it remains unclear whether these changes can be harmful.
The study, published yesterday in the Journal of the American Medical Association, found that just 50 minutes of cell phone use can noticeably speed up brain activity in the region closest to the phone's antenna. ...
